Output 0d3a5ba4159c97ce4f8ed38fb1d75fb3fb67e633de1337d50f25fb56a63728be:0

value
316035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8dde6599281f2ecd0ecc9426599c62de9f1758d OP_EQUAL
address
3MThhr8K9vVUPjC78zMZLkMVsWDBWXLSd6
transaction
0d3a5ba4159c97ce4f8ed38fb1d75fb3fb67e633de1337d50f25fb56a63728be